Understanding Glass Condensation

What is Glass Condensation?

Condensation on glass happens when warm, damp air enters contact with a cooler surface. As the warm air cools, it loses its capacity to hold moisture and the water vapor condenses into liquid beads on the glass. This phenomenon is particularly common in Misted Double Glazing UK-glazed windows, where moisture can become caught in between the panes.

Causes of Glass Condensation

  1. Temperature level Differences: When the inside air is warmer than the outside air, condensation is more likely to form on the Glass Condensation Repair surfaces.
  2. High Humidity Levels: During seasons of high humidity, such as summer, the moisture material in the air boosts, leading to more condensation opportunities on glass surfaces.
  3. Poor Ventilation: Inadequate air flow can trap humid air in enclosed spaces, increasing the probability of condensation.
  4. Faulty Seals in Double-Glazing Units: If the seals in double-glazed windows stop working, moisture can go into the airspace between the panes, resulting in condensation problems.

Impacts of Glass Condensation

  • Increased Energy Costs: Condensation can result in thermal inadequacy, causing homes to lose heat throughout winter season.
  • Mold Growth: Moist environments promote the development of mold and mildew, posing health dangers.
  • Structural Damage: Prolonged moisture can damage Window Repair Service frames and cause rot.

Methods for Glass Condensation Repair

Repairing glass condensation mostly depends upon the source of the problem. Here are numerous techniques to think about:

1. Improving Ventilation

Desc|x|ription: Enhancing airflow within a room helps in reducing humidity levels.

Actions:

  • Open windows to enable fresh air to distribute.
  • Usage exhaust fans in bathroom and kitchens to expel moist air.
  • Think about installing a whole-house ventilation system.

2. Utilizing Dehumidifiers

Desc|x|ription: A dehumidifier can efficiently reduce indoor humidity, helping to eliminate condensation.

Pros:

  • Highly reliable in damp environments.
  • Adjustable settings for various spaces.

3. Repairing or Replacing Window Seals

Desc|x|ription: If double-glazed windows are fogged up, the seals might be jeopardized. Repairing or changing these seals can prevent moisture from getting in.

Actions:

  • Remove the existing sealant.
  • Clean the pertinent surface areas.
  • Use a replacement seal or think about a professional repair.

4. Window Treatments

Desc|x|ription: Using window treatments can assist insulate your windows.

Types:

  • Thermal curtains: These can help keep warm air in and cool air out.
  • Window film: This can assist decrease heat transfer.

5. Glass Replacement

Desc|x|ription: If condensation persists and shows a larger issue, replacing the glass system may be needed.

Signs that replacement is needed:

  • Persistent fogging that doesn't clear.
  • Visible damage to the glass.

Prevention Tips

Avoiding glass condensation is frequently more efficient than repairing it post-formation. Here are numerous methods to reduce the likelihood of condensation on glass surfaces:

  • Maintain Indoor Temperature: Keep indoor temperature levels constant to minimize the event of condensation.
  • Usage Humidity Monitoring: Install hygrometers to track humidity levels inside. Go for a humidity level below 60%.
  • Insulate Windows: Use insulated window units to restrict thermal distinctions in between inside and outside.
  • Seal Leaks: Regularly look for leakages in Misted Window Repair Kit frames and walls; seal these accordingly to prevent air infiltration.
